#08f50e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#08f50e is composed of 3.1% red, 96.1% green and 5.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 96.7% cyan, 0% magenta, 94.3% yellow and 3.9% black. It has a hue angle of 121.5 degrees, a saturation of 93.7% and a lightness of 49.6%. #08f50e color hex could be obtained by blending #10ff1c with #00eb00. Closest websafe color is: #00ff00.

● #08f50e color description : Vivid lime green.
#08f50e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#08f50e has RGB values of R:8, G:245, B:14 and CMYK values of C:0.97, M:0, Y:0.94, K:0.04. Its decimal value is 587022.
